Hereditary congenital goitre with thyroglobulin deficiency causing hypothyroidism
Clinical Endocrinology
|June 1, 1984
Summary
This study investigates a rare form of goitrous hypothyroidism caused by defective thyroglobulin (Tg) production. Researchers found impaired Tg export or synthesis leads to insufficient thyroid hormone storage and goiter.

Background:
- Investigates a rare genetic disorder causing goitrous hypothyroidism.
- Focuses on thyroid gland dysfunction in affected siblings and a related patient.
Observation:
- High iodide uptake with negative perchlorate discharge test.
- Elevated serum protein-bound iodine and low T4, suggesting iodoalbumin presence.
- Normal to low-normal serum T3, elevated TSH, and exaggerated TSH response to TRH.
Findings:
- Undetectable to low-normal serum thyroglobulin (Tg) levels.
- Thyroid tissue showed significantly reduced immunoreactive Tg and absence of mature 18-20S Tg.
- Iodide remained associated with undigested proteins, indicating impaired hormone synthesis.
Implications:
- Defective Tg export or synthesis leads to deficient hormone storage and goiter.
- Potential link between this condition and atypical histological features, including possible malignancy.
- Highlights the critical role of adequate Tg production and storage in thyroid function.
